Finding the Right Visa Lawyer in Danielson, Connecticut
Navigating the U.S. immigration system can be a complex and daunting process, especially for residents of smaller communities like Danielson, Connecticut. Whether you are seeking a work visa, a family-based green card, or navigating status adjustments, having a knowledgeable visa lawyer by your side is not just helpful—it can be critical to the success of your application. In Danielson and the surrounding Windham County area, finding specialized legal support requires understanding what a qualified immigration attorney does and how to identify one who can serve your specific needs effectively.
A visa lawyer, or immigration attorney, is a legal professional licensed to practice law and accredited to represent clients before U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S), immigration courts, and consulates abroad. Their role extends far beyond simply filling out forms. They provide strategic advice tailored to your unique circumstances, help you gather and prepare the necessary supporting evidence, and represent you in communications and proceedings with government agencies. For individuals and families in Danielson, this local expertise is invaluable, as an attorney familiar with the area can also connect you with local resources, translators, or community support networks that might be beneficial to your case.
When searching for a visa lawyer in Danielson, it's important to verify their credentials. Ensure they are members in good standing with the Connecticut Bar Association and, ideally, members of the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A). This membership indicates a dedicated focus on immigration law. You can start your search by asking for referrals from trusted community centers, local organizations that serve immigrant populations, or even your employer if your case is employment-based. While Danielson itself is a smaller town, many attorneys serving the region may have offices in nearby cities like Norwich or Willimantic but are accessible to Danielson residents.
Be prepared for your initial consultation. Bring any relevant documents, such as passports, prior immigration paperwork, and letters from family or employers. A good lawyer will ask detailed questions about your background and goals to assess your options honestly. They should provide a clear explanation of the process, potential timelines, fees, and the likelihood of success for your particular visa category. Be wary of anyone who guarantees results or asks for large upfront payments without a detailed contract.
Remember, immigration law is federal, so a lawyer licensed in Connecticut can practice it anywhere in the United States. However, choosing an attorney familiar with the Danielson community can offer a more personalized and supportive experience. They understand the local context and can be more readily available for in-person meetings when needed. Taking the time to find a competent and trustworthy visa lawyer is one of the most important steps you can take to secure your future in northeastern Connecticut.
